Football Recap: Enka Jets vs. Pisgah Bears
If Enka was feeling good off their 48-8 takedown of Owen last Friday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Enka Jets took a blow against the Pisgah Bears on Friday, falling 49-14. The Jets were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 35-14.
Enka's defeat shouldn't obscure the performances of William Parham, who picked up 166 receiving yards and a touchdown, and Logan Trantham, who threw for 173 yards and a touchdown on only ten passes. With that strong performance, Parham is now averaging an impressive 100.5 receiving yards per game.
Pisgah can attribute much of their success to Aaron Clark, who rushed for 33 yards and a touchdown, and also threw for 164 yards while completing 90% of his passes.
Enka's loss dropped their record down to 1-1. As for Pisgah, their victory was their seventh stra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 1-1.
Enka will face off against Rosman at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Pisgah, they will challenge Hampton at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
